当我使用 Python 在 VS Code 中运行代码时,但输出如下: invalid sntax

编程


当我执行代码时,我认为代码有错误,但是当我执行任何代码时,终端是这样的
示例01:

import requests
from bs4 import BeautifulSoup
url = "https://quotes.toscrape.com/"
response = requests.get(url)
if response.status_code == 200:
    soup = BeautifulSoup(response.text , 'html.parser')
    authors_names = soup.find_all('span',class_= 'authors')
    for author_name in authors_names:
       print(author_name.get_text())
else:
    print(f'failed to retrieve the page.status_code:{response.status_code}')

示例 02:
一个= 5
打印(一)

终端:

File "<stdin>", line 1
    & "C:/Program Files/Python312/python.exe" "c:/Users/Dell/python.py/web scraping.py/test 11.py"

我尝试过的:

我已卸载 VS Code 并安装,但在终端中遇到同样的问题

解决方案1

如果您检查从该网站返回的文本,您会注意到两件事:
1. 没有“authors”类的“span”类型的项目。
2. 有“小”类型的项目,其类别为“作者”。

コメント

タイトルとURLをコピーしました